How to Get Started in the Art of Painting

Painting is a form of visual art that uses shape, color, line, tones, and textures to create an image on a flat surface. It can represent real experiences or be wholly abstract. It has been a part of human culture for thousands of years and can be found in a variety of settings, including caves, temples, and homes.

There are many ways to paint, but the most important aspect is having a clear goal in mind for what you want to accomplish. This could be something as simple as learning to paint realistically or attempting to recreate a famous piece of artwork. Whatever it is, make sure that you set a realistic goal for yourself and then dedicate the time and effort to learn everything you can about painting.

You should also decide what type of painting you want to do and what materials to use. There are many different types of paints and a wide range of supplies available, so take the time to learn about them all. Choosing a medium that you enjoy working with will make the process more fun and allow you to focus on the technical aspects of painting. For beginners, acrylics are often a good choice as they are easy to work with and can be used on a variety of surfaces.

It is also a good idea to practice drawing before you start painting. Sketching out a rough version of what you want to paint will help you to organize your thoughts and give you a better sense of how to approach the project. You can also use this exercise to refine your style, allowing you to develop your own artistic voice.

After you’ve decided on a subject, it is crucial to determine how you want the viewer to react to the painting. This will help you decide what elements to include and where to place them in the composition. For example, do you want the focal point to be a particular tree or a bowl of fruit? Choosing the right focal point will help the viewer travel through your painting and see more than what is immediately obvious.
